电铁并联电容补偿装置差压保护整定方法的改进研究

摘    要:并联电容补偿装置是我国电气化铁道提高功率因数、降低谐波影响的重要设备。结合电气化铁道实际负荷特性对并联电容补偿装置差压保护的现行整定方法进行了深入分析,得出由于负荷特性显著不同,电力系统常用的电容器差压保护的整定方法并不适用于3次谐波含量较大的电铁并联电容补偿装置;根据实际运行需要提出了两种不同的改进方法并进行了详细计算和比较,建议采用单支电容器开路故障退出造成的不平衡电压作为电铁并联电容补偿装置差压保护的整定值。

Study of improving setting method of differential voltage protection for parallel capacitor compensation equipment in electrified railway

Abstract:Parallel capacitor compensation equipment has very important effect in improving power factor and decreasing the harmonic waves influence in electrified railway.In this paper,the existing setting method of the different voltage protection for parallel capacitor compensation equipment considering the harmonic load characteristic of electrified railway is discussed and the result is found that the existing setting method is not adoptive to the electrified railway in China.Then two improving setting methods considering the real experience are proposed and compared in detail in this paper.The conclusion are suggested that the unbalanced voltage caused by one capacitor unit opening exit will be proper setting value.
